在职场竞争中,理论知识与实战经验往往是决定成败的关键因素。许多人在学习过程中积累了丰富的理论知识,但在实际工作中却难以将其转化为有效的职场利器。本文将深入探讨如何将理论知识转化为职场实战能力,帮助您在职场中脱颖而出。

一、理解理论知识的核心价值

1.1 理论知识的基础作用

理论知识是实践工作的基石,它能够帮助我们建立正确的认知框架,为后续的实践提供理论支持。例如,在项目管理中,掌握项目管理的理论框架有助于我们更好地理解项目实施的全过程。

1.2 理论知识的应用拓展

理论知识不仅可以指导我们的实践,还可以激发我们的创造性思维,拓展应用领域。例如,在软件开发领域,了解设计模式理论可以帮助我们写出更高质量的代码。

二、将理论知识转化为实战技能的步骤

2.1 深入理解理论知识

首先,我们需要对所学理论知识进行深入理解,包括其原理、适用范围和局限性。以下是一个深入理解理论知识的示例:

# 示例:深入理解面向对象编程(OOP)理论
class Dog:
    def __init__(self, name, age):
        self.name = name
        self.age = age

    def bark(self):
        print(f"{self.name} says: Woof!")

# 创建一个Dog对象并调用其方法
my_dog = Dog("Buddy", 5)
my_dog.bark()

2.2 将理论知识应用于实际问题

将理论知识应用于实际问题,是检验我们对知识掌握程度的关键步骤。以下是一个应用理论知识的示例:

# 示例:使用面向对象编程(OOP)理论解决实际问题
class Customer:
    def __init__(self, name, balance):
        self.name = name
        self.balance = balance

    def deposit(self, amount):
        self.balance += amount
        print(f"{self.name} deposited ${amount}. New balance: ${self.balance}")

    def withdraw(self, amount):
        if amount <= self.balance:
            self.balance -= amount
            print(f"{self.name} withdrew ${amount}. New balance: ${self.balance}")
        else:
            print(f"{self.name} cannot withdraw ${amount}. Insufficient funds.")

# 创建两个Customer对象并执行存款和取款操作
customer1 = Customer("Alice", 100)
customer1.deposit(50)
customer1.withdraw(20)

customer2 = Customer("Bob", 200)
customer2.withdraw(250)

2.3 反思与总结

在应用理论知识的过程中,我们要不断反思自己的实践,总结经验教训。以下是一个反思与总结的示例:

# 示例:反思面向对象编程(OOP)理论在项目中的应用
# 1. 分析项目中存在的问题
# 2. 思考如何利用OOP理论改进项目设计
# 3. 制定改进计划并实施

三、培养实战能力的技巧

3.1 多实践、多总结

实践是检验真理的唯一标准。在职场中,我们要不断实践,总结经验,提高自己的实战能力。

3.2 建立人脉网络

人脉网络可以帮助我们获取更多的实战机会,拓展视野。因此,在职场中,我们要积极建立人脉网络。

3.3 持续学习

职场竞争激烈,我们要保持持续学习的态度,不断更新自己的知识体系,适应时代发展。

四、总结

将理论知识转化为职场利器,需要我们深入理解理论知识、将其应用于实际问题,并不断反思总结。通过多实践、多总结、建立人脉网络和持续学习,我们可以将理论知识转化为实战能力,在职场中取得成功。